I applied through a staffing agency. I interviewed at The Y (YMCA) (Putnam, CT) in Mar 2017
Interview
The interview process was very casual, just a brief meeting with one of the directors to get to know your experience with children. This is followed by a "shadow day" in the program.
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
-Why do you want to work with children at the YMCA?
-What is your past experience with childcare?
-Do you have any siblings?
